In <URL: https://bugs.debian.org/cgi-bin/bugreport.cgi?bug=580773 >,
there is a suggestion to rename insserv options --dryrun and --showall
to --dry-run and --show-all, to match other programs with such
options.
I counted how many manual pages on my machine use --dryrun (1) and
--dry-run (17), so bringing insserv in line with the other tools seem
like a good idea.
I found no other --showall nor --show-all options, so it is less
relevant. There are some starting with --show, and 34 starting with
--show-, so --show-all would be more in line with the rest, I guess.
The argument to change seem compelling to me, as it is a good thing to
have consistent options across all command line tools. Any
objections?
I counted using commands similar to this:
zgrep -- --dryrun /usr/share/man/man*/*|wc -l
zgrep -- --dry-run /usr/share/man/man*/*|wc -l
